Handover note — Crumbwheel order cutoffs.

Welcome aboard. The bakery cutoff rule in Crumbwheel closes same-day orders at 14:00 local to each storefront, not UTC — this has bitten us twice. Holiday overrides live in the calendar service and take precedence silently, so always check there first when a cutoff looks wrong. To unlock the calendar service's admin console after a restart, enter the recovery passphrase below.

vault phrase of bagap-bahaf = silion-pelox-sorox-casdor-quenwyn-fraax-eliox-praael-kelion-quenvan-kasox-rusael-norius-belvan

Action item: The Relayn deploy-status bot silently dropped updates when the pipeline API paginated results, so responders believed a rollback had completed when it had not. We will add pagination handling, a staleness banner, and an integration test. Until merged, verify deploy state directly in the pipeline console, documented at the page below.

runbook for kahop-kajop: https://rundeck.ordinio.test/display/secrets/pipeline/issue/pages/repo/browse/e5732776e07d1285107e5aeb

## Account Recovery — Trailnote Offline Mode

When a surveyor's Trailnote app has been offline for 30+ days, their local credentials expire and sync refuses to resume. Don't make them wipe the device — all their unsynced field data lives there! Instead, open the support console, pick "Offline Reinstate," and enter their handle. The console will ask for the support team's shared recovery passphrase before issuing a reinstatement token. Use the one below.

unlock words, bagaf-fajeg: zorael-kelax-fraath-quenix-eliok-sileth-aldmir-wenir-druiel

Facilities ticket — Halewick Tower, night shift.

Issue: support team reporting east stairwell reader rejecting badges after midnight. Reader was reset this morning; firmware updated. Overnight crew should now badge as normal. If the reader fails again, use the manual keypad by the fire door — do not prop the door. Log any further failures with the time and badge name. Temporary keypad code for the fallback door is below.

door code, tajeg-fawip: bdg-K-62